Home » US Law » 2022 West Virginia Code » Chapter 47. Regulation of Trade » Article 9. Uniform Limited Partnership Act » §47-9-20. Person Erroneously Believing Himself Limited Partner

(a) Except as provided in subsection (b) of this section, a person who makes a contribution to a business enterprise and erroneously but in good faith believes that he has become a limited partner in the enterprise is not a general partner in the enterprise and is not bound by its obligations by reason of making the contribution, receiving distributions from the enterprise, or exercising any rights of a limited partner, if, on ascertaining the mistake, he

(1) Causes an appropriate certificate of limited partnership or a certificate of amendment to be executed and filed; or
